Transaction 65a9616ab832bc2ef31562c5a5fa4da6e517a0e18e3f8ae0ea496bb46daa0988
1 Input
1 Output
-
65a9616ab832bc2ef31562c5a5fa4da6e517a0e18e3f8ae0ea496bb46daa0988:0
- value
- 51097
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7f9c7eb220ecc3312d1100a2adfa318fb66dd7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 154Hc2iq5ZSjC6ePCkBg4QPaFeNpn6A6jE